China urges US for pragmatic peaceful ties in new era

Post by : Minna

Photo: AFP

China’s Foreign Minister, Wang Yi, has asked the United States (US) to adopt a fair, practical, and respectful attitude towards China. He said this would help both countries build a better and more peaceful relationship in the future.

Where Did He Say This?

Wang Yi made these remarks during a meeting with US Secretary of State Marco Rubio. This meeting took place on the sidelines of the 58th ASEAN Foreign Ministers’ Meeting and other related meetings held recently.

What Did They Discuss?

Both leaders talked about China-US relations and other important topics that matter to both countries. Wang Yi clearly explained China’s main ideas and expectations for improving relations with the US.

He said that both countries should turn their top leaders’ agreements into real actions and policies. Wang Yi explained:

“We hope the US will look at China in an objective and fair way. Both countries should aim for peaceful coexistence and mutual benefits. They must treat each other with equality and respect to build a strong and positive relationship for this new era.”

How Was The Meeting?

The statement from China noted that both sides felt the meeting was positive, practical, and helpful. They agreed to:

  • Strengthen diplomatic channels
  • Communicate better at all levels
  • Use diplomatic efforts to improve ties

Manage differences calmly

  • Find new ways to cooperate in the future
  • Wang Yi’s Message at the East Asia Summit
  • Besides his meeting with the US Secretary of State, Wang Yi also spoke at the 15th East Asia Summit Foreign Ministers’ Meeting.

There, he shared three main proposals for East Asian countries:

  • Return to dialogue – Solve problems by talking to each other peacefully.
  • Focus on development – Work together to improve their countries’ economies and the lives of their people.
  • Remain open to cooperation – Do not isolate themselves but continue working with other countries.

He also supported adopting a special declaration for the summit’s 20th anniversary, which would set the direction for future development in East Asia.

Warning Against Protectionism

Wang Yi warned that protectionism and doing things alone are dangerous for the region. He said East Asia has been successful because of open regional cooperation. He added:

“China supports ASEAN-led cooperation. We want to protect fair trade, build a strong regional free trade network, and promote better regional integration.”

What Does This Mean?

This means China wants to work closely with its neighbours and the US. China wants to:

  • Keep peace and stability in the region
  • Improve economic ties with the US
  • Ensure fair and equal treatment for all countries
  • Solve differences through dialogue, not fights

Why Is This Important?

The relationship between China and the US affects the entire world. If both countries work together peacefully and respect each other, it can bring more development, stability, and better opportunities not only for their people but also for many other countries that depend on their trade and support.
